eval: Make sort always stable
Should fix test failures on QB:
20:00:51,837 INFO - not ok 420 - sort() sorts “wrong” values between -0.0001 and 0.0001, preserving order
20:00:51,837 INFO - # test/functional/eval/sort_spec.lua @ 21
20:00:51,837 INFO - # Failure message: test/functional/eval/sort_spec.lua:39: Expected objects to be the same.
20:00:51,837 INFO - # Passed in:
20:00:51,837 INFO - # (string) '[-1.0e-4, v:true, v:false, v:null, function('tr'), {'a': 42}, 'check', [], 1.0e-4]'
20:00:51,837 INFO - # Expected:
20:00:51,837 INFO - # (string) '[-1.0e-4, function('tr'), v:true, v:false, v:null, [], {'a': 42}, 'check', 1.0e-4]'
20:00:51,837 INFO - # stack traceback:
20:00:51,837 INFO - # test/functional/eval/sort_spec.lua:39: in function <test/functional/eval/sort_spec.lua:22>
20:00:51,837 INFO - #
